April, I agree with you. If i were in your shoes i wouldn't waite for 6 more months for a dr. to tell me what to do. I have a 2yr old that was diagnosed with reflux at age 41/2 mnths. She also has a double drainage system on her right kidney (two ureters) ... when she was first diagnosed we went through several test. Has your son had a VCUG? Or a renal ultrasound? If you have not taken him to a pediatric urologist - I would recommend that you do so. Our little one is on a maint. antibiotic every night to prevent infection and to try and prevent any kidney damg. but in a few months we are going to have surgery to fix the problem. If i were you i would get another opinion from a ped.urologist asap. Best of luck with your son.
